The plan here sketched, and which was eventually adopted, had a double chance of success. Either Sherman, going down the Mississippi to the mouth of the Yazoo, could present a new base for Grant, from which the latter could supply himself, when he also struck the Yazoo, in the interior; or, if this should be found impracticable or less desirable, Grant could hold the main body of the enemy at, or near Grenada, confronting him, while Sherman might step in and take Vicksburg. By this strategy, Grant assumed what seemed the more ungrateful part of the undertaking, leaving the prize of the campaign to be secured by his subordinate. The same peculiarity was also conspicuous in some of his later programmes, but in each instance, Fortune overruled his arrangements and brought about her own conclusions, apparently resolved to dispose of her own favors.

On the 5th of the month, in reply to Grant's suggestions, Halleck directed him not to attempt to hold the country south of the Tallahatchie, but to collect twenty-five thousand troops at Memphis, by the 20th, for the Vicksburg expedition. On the 7th, Grant answered that he would send two divisions to Memphis in a few days, and asked: ‘Do you want me to command the expedition to Vicksburg, or shall I send Sherman?’ To which Halleck replied: ‘You may move your troops as you may deem best to accomplish the great object in view. . .
